Step 1: Locate the Keyhole

The keyhole on a Chevy Cruze is typically located on the driver’s side door handle. It may be covered by a small rubber flap. Remove the flap to expose the keyhole.

Step 2: Insert the Key

Insert the key into the keyhole and turn it to the right. The key should fit snugly and turn smoothly. If it doesn’t, ensure you are using the correct key.

Step 3: Turn the Key

Once the key is inserted, turn it to the right until you hear a click. This will unlock the door and allow you to open it.

Step 4: Open the Door

After unlocking the door, pull the handle towards you to open it. If the door is stuck, try jiggling the handle while pulling.

Step 5: Unlock Other Doors (Optional)

If you need to unlock other doors, repeat steps 1-4 for each door.

Step 6: Lock the Car

To lock the car with a key, insert the key into the keyhole and turn it to the left. This will lock all the doors and activate the security system.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Key Not Turning

  • Ensure you are using the correct key.
  • Check if the keyhole is blocked by dirt or debris. Clean it if necessary.
  • If the key still doesn’t turn, contact a locksmith or dealership.

Door Not Opening

  • Make sure the door is unlocked by turning the key to the right.
  • Try jiggling the handle while pulling.
  • If the door remains stuck, contact a locksmith.

Remote Key Fob Not Working

  • Check if the battery in the remote key fob is dead. Replace it if necessary.
  • Resynchronize the remote key fob with the car. Refer to your owner’s manual for instructions.
